Transaction debb26dd303098c510a471773afbd93db5d51c2001dd258d54b37737ef3693fd
1 Input
1 Output
-
debb26dd303098c510a471773afbd93db5d51c2001dd258d54b37737ef3693fd: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f4daaa538511e62cb68b47019c296aef4b2669a61a9796ee7ecd10f6487602d1
- address
- bc1p7nd255u9z8nzed5tguqec2t2aa9jv6dxr2tedmn7e5g0vjrkqtgsxhqwf2